How 75604 compares in the Longview, TX area

ZIP code 75604 (Longview, TX) has a typical home value of $221,075 as of July 2026, ranking 14th of 27 ZIP codes tracked in the Longview, TX area, more expensive than about 52% of ZIP codes in the metro. Prices here have moved -1.0% over the trailing 12 months. Over the past five years, the typical value in this ZIP code has changed +26.2%, from $175,201 in July 2021 to $221,075 in July 2026. Against observed rent, the typical home here sells for 17.9× the annual rent ($1,029/mo), a common way to gauge whether buying looks cheap relative to renting in this ZIP code.

Population and demographics

ZIP code 75604 has a population of 31,714, per the Census Bureau's American Community Survey 5-year estimate. By race and ethnicity: 57.8% White, 19.3% Hispanic or Latino, 16.8% Black or African American, 4.9% two or more races, 0.9% Asian, 0.1% American Indian or Alaska Native, and 0.1%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ander.
